I am new here and this is the first time I have looked at your build. I am impressed at the thought put into this and workmanship. A few years ago I built a 73 Camaro with a single 91mm T6 turbo and a BBC. It took 2 years to complete and I had a WHOLE new respect for pipe fitters and fab work. It taught me how important it was to think ahead when fabbing. I believe I did everything at least 3 times before moving on to the next thing. ha ha

Your build gives me the urge to do a turbo in the 56 but I'm not sure I have the patience to do another.

Oh, I saw where you have a ring gland lift on a piston. If you know at what psi your were running win it let go, you may want to bump your waste gate down a couple psi. That normally happens when the ring gaps close and butt due to tight gaps using boost.

I never did summarize what changes I made with the most recent tear down. 1 used eBay piston and rod, eBay head studs, ls9 head gaskets, arp cam bolts, new lifters. Nothing to add more performance, just some small things for reliability (hopefully).
